ALBAWABA – According to relevant authorities, the drug test against Saad El Soghayar will begin on October 27 in front of Circuit 19 North Cairo.

After Saad returned from the United States, the opposition judge in Cairo decided to keep him in prison for another 15 days on drug possession charges on September 12.

On September 10, police arrested Saad El Soghayar at Cairo airport on suspicion of cocaine possession.

Although the case or verdict is not yet clear, a few days ago the family of Saad El Soghayar released a statement announcing the punishment for anyone who published the text of the investigation into his latest case, in which he was accused of drug use is suspected.

The investigation resulted in a report, a complaint and a statement. In addition, Saad El Soghayar’s family criticized news websites for accessing investigations without proper authorization and called on the Attorney General to assist in the investigation.
